WebApr 2, 2024 · Secant (sec), Cosecant (cosec) and Cotangent (cot) Functions. Cot, sec and cosec are the three additional trigonometric functions that can be derived from the primary functions of sine, cos, and tan. The relation between the primary functions and Secant, cosecant (csc) and cotangent are: Sec θ = 1/ (cos θ) = Hypotenuse/Adjacent = AC/AB. Web10.5. =. 0.79. To graph the sine function, we mark the angle along the horizontal x axis, and for each angle, we put the sine of that angle on the vertical y-axis. The result, as seen above, is a smooth curve that varies from +1 to -1. Curves that follow this shape are called 'sinusoidal' after the name of the sine function. WebSection 9 Graphs of Other Trigonometric Functions. Graphs of the Reciprocal Functions. The sine and cosecant functions are reciprocals of each other. When sin x = 0, then csc x = 1/0, and there is a vertical asymptote at those values of x. WebInverse trigonometric functions are simply defined as the inverse functions of the basic trigonometric functions which are sine, cosine, tangent, cotangent, secant, and cosecant functions. They are also termed as arcus functions, antitrigonometric functions or cyclometric functions. WebBelow are the graphs of the three trigonometry functions sin x, cos x, and tan x. In these trigonometry graphs, x-axis values of the angles are in radians, and on the y-axis, its f (x) is taken, the value of the function at each given angle.
